9 years agoMdePkg: UefiScsiLib: do not encode LUN in CDB for other SCSI commands
Laszlo Ersek [Fri, 28 Nov 2014 10:24:56 +0000 (10:24 +0000)]
MdePkg: UefiScsiLib: do not encode LUN in CDB for other SCSI commands

The TEST UNIT READY, INQUIRY, MODE SENSE, REQUEST SENSE and READ CAPACITY
commands define bits [7:5] of Cdb[1] as Reserved (potentially as part of a
larger Reserved bitfield):

  Command             Reserved bitfield in Cdb[1]  SCSI spec reference
  ------------------  ---------------------------  -------------------
  TEST UNIT READY     all bits                     SPC-4 6.37
  INQUIRY             bits [7:2]                   SPC-4 6.4.1
  MODE SENSE (6)      bits [7:4]                   SPC-4 6.11.1
  MODE SENSE (10)     bits [7:5]                   SPC-4 6.12
  REQUEST SENSE       bits [7:1]                   SPC-4 6.29
  READ CAPACITY (10)  bits [7:1]                   SBC-3 5.16
  READ CAPACITY (16)  bits [7:5]                   SBC-3 5.17

Update the UefiScsiLib functions accordingly.

(In ScsiReadCapacity16Command() the LUN has not been encoded, so there we
just remove the useless ScsiIo->GetDeviceLocation() call, with its
auxiliary local variables.)

The EFI_SCSI_TARGET_MAX_BYTES and EFI_SCSI_LOGICAL_UNIT_NUMBER_MASK macros
become unused with this patch, remove them too.

9 years agoMdePkg: UefiScsiLib: do not encode LUN in CDB for READ and WRITE
Laszlo Ersek [Fri, 28 Nov 2014 10:24:41 +0000 (10:24 +0000)]
MdePkg: UefiScsiLib: do not encode LUN in CDB for READ and WRITE

The "SCSI Block Commands - 2" (SBC-2) standard defines bits [7:5] of the
CDB byte 1 as Reserved, for the READ and WRITE commands.

The updated "SCSI Block Commands - 3" (SBC-3) standard defines the same
bitfield as RDPROTECT and WRPROTECT, respectively.

After reviewing the above standards, and the following commits:
- SVN r8331 (git 676e2a32),
- SVN r8334 (git 6b3ecf5c),
we've determined that UefiScsiLib is incorrect in encoding the LUN in this
bitfield for the READ and WRITE commands.

Encoding a nonzero LUN there creates unintended RDPROTECT and WRPROTECT
values, which the recipient device is required to reject if it does not
support protection information, with CHECK CONDITION, ILLEGAL REQUEST,
INVALID FIELD IN CDB:

  ScsiDiskRead10: Check Condition happened!
  ScsiDisk: Sense Key = 0x5 ASC = 0x24!
  ScsiDiskRead10: Check Condition happened!
  ScsiDisk: Sense Key = 0x5 ASC = 0x24!
  ScsiDiskRead10: Check Condition happened!
  ScsiDisk: Sense Key = 0x5 ASC = 0x24!
  ScsiDiskRead10: Check Condition happened!
  ScsiDisk: Sense Key = 0x5 ASC = 0x24!
  FatOpenDevice: read of part_lba failed Device Error

In practice this flaw breaks UefiScsiLib minimally on SCSI disks with
nonzero LUNs that are emulated by QEMU (after QEMU commit 96bdbbab, part
of v1.2.0).

9 years agoOvmfPkg: AcpiPlatformDxe: make dependency on PCI enumeration explicit
Laszlo Ersek [Thu, 20 Nov 2014 09:58:28 +0000 (09:58 +0000)]
OvmfPkg: AcpiPlatformDxe: make dependency on PCI enumeration explicit

The ACPI payload that OVMF downloads from QEMU via fw_cfg depends on the
PCI enumaration and resource assignment performed by
MdeModulePkg/Bus/Pci/PciBusDxe.

Namely, although the ACPI payload is pre-generated in qemu during machine
initialization, in

  main()                                            [vl.c]
    qemu_run_machine_init_done_notifiers()
      pc_guest_info_machine_done()                  [hw/i386/pc.c]
        acpi_setup()                                [hw/i386/acpi-build.c]
          acpi_build()
          acpi_add_rom_blob()
            rom_add_blob(... acpi_build_update ...) [hw/core/loader.c]
              fw_cfg_add_file_callback()            [hw/nvram/fw_cfg.c]

the ACPI data is rebuilt at the first time any of the related fw_cfg files
are read, through the acpi_build_update() fw_cfg read-callback function:

  fw_cfg_read()                                     [hw/nvram/fw_cfg.c]
    acpi_build_update()                             [hw/i386/acpi-build.c]
      acpi_build()

(See qemu commit d87072ceeccf4f84a64d4bc59124bcd64286c070 and its
containing series.)

For this reason we must not dispatch AcpiPlatformDxe before PciBusDxe
completes the enumeration.

Luckily, the PI Specification 1.3 defines
EFI_PCI_ENUMERATION_COMPLETE_GUID in Volume 5, "10.9 End of PCI
Enumeration Overview", as an indicia to inform the platform when the PCI
enumeration process has completed. PciBusDxe installs this protocol at the
end of the PciEnumerator() function.

Let's add this GUID to the Depex section of AcpiPlatformDxe, in order to
state the dependency explicitly.

On Xen, and on older QEMU where the linker/loader fw_cfg interface is
unavailable, this introduces a harmless ordering constraint -- we'll
always include PciBusDxe in OVMF, so the dependency will always be
satisfied.

I tested this change as follows:

- I dumped the ACPI tables in a Fedora 20 guest, before and after the
  change, and compared them. The only thing that actually changed was the
  FACS address. (Which I promptly tested with S3 suspend/resume.) Plus, of
  course, the FACP checksum changed, because the FACP links the FACS.

- Tested S3 in my Windows Server 2008 R2 and Windows Server 2012 R2 guests.

9 years agoSecurityPkg: VariableServiceSetVariable(): fix dbt <-> GUID association
Laszlo Ersek [Fri, 14 Nov 2014 13:47:14 +0000 (13:47 +0000)]
SecurityPkg: VariableServiceSetVariable(): fix dbt <-> GUID association

SVN r16380 ("UEFI 2.4 X509 Certificate Hash and RFC3161 Timestamp
Verification support for Secure Boot") broke the "dbt" variable's
association with its expected namespace GUID.

According to "MdePkg/Include/Guid/ImageAuthentication.h", *all* of the
"db", "dbx", and "dbt" (== EFI_IMAGE_SECURITY_DATABASE2) variables have
their special meanings in the EFI_IMAGE_SECURITY_DATABASE_GUID namespace.

However, the above commit introduced the following expression in
VariableServiceSetVariable():

> -  } else if (CompareGuid (VendorGuid, &gEfiImageSecurityDatabaseGuid) &&
> -          ((StrCmp (VariableName, EFI_IMAGE_SECURITY_DATABASE) == 0) || (StrCmp (VariableName, EFI_IMAGE_SECURITY_DATABASE1) == 0))) {
> +  } else if (CompareGuid (VendorGuid, &gEfiImageSecurityDatabaseGuid) &&
> +          ((StrCmp (VariableName, EFI_IMAGE_SECURITY_DATABASE) == 0) || (StrCmp (VariableName, EFI_IMAGE_SECURITY_DATABASE1) == 0))
> +           || (StrCmp (VariableName, EFI_IMAGE_SECURITY_DATABASE2)) == 0) {

Simply replacing the individual expressions with the predicates
"GuidMatch", "DbMatch", "DbxMatch", and "DbtMatch", the above
transformation becomes:

> -  } else if (GuidMatch &&
> -          ((DbMatch) || (DbxMatch))) {
> +  } else if (GuidMatch &&
> +          ((DbMatch) || (DbxMatch))
> +           || DbtMatch) {

In shorter form, we change

  GuidMatch && (DbMatch || DbxMatch)

into

  GuidMatch && (DbMatch || DbxMatch) || DbtMatch

which is incorrect, because this way "dbt" will match outside of the
intended namespace / GUID.

The error was caught by gcc:

> SecurityPkg/VariableAuthenticated/RuntimeDxe/Variable.c: In function
> 'VariableServiceSetVariable':
>
> SecurityPkg/VariableAuthenticated/RuntimeDxe/Variable.c:3188:71: error:
> suggest parentheses around '&&' within '||' [-Werror=parentheses]
>
>    } else if (CompareGuid (VendorGuid, &gEfiImageSecurityDatabaseGuid) &&
>                                                                        ^
> cc1: all warnings being treated as errors

Fix the parentheses.

This change may have security implications.

9 years agoCryptoPkg: OpenSslSupport.h: edk2-ize offsetof() macro for gcc-4.8 / X64
Laszlo Ersek [Fri, 14 Nov 2014 10:24:33 +0000 (10:24 +0000)]
CryptoPkg: OpenSslSupport.h: edk2-ize offsetof() macro for gcc-4.8 / X64

Code added in SVN r16339 ("CryptoPkg Updates to support RFC3161 timestamp
signature verification.") introduced many new uses of the offsetof()
macro. Since the offsetof() macro in "OpenSslSupport.h" casts a pointer to
an "int", it triggers a large number of

  error: cast from pointer to integer of different size
  [-Werror=pointer-to-int-cast]

errors when building CryptoPkg with gcc-4.8 for X64.

Remedy this by directing offsetof() to the OFFSET_OF() macro in
"MdePkg/Include/Base.h" (which matches how "OpenSslSupport.h" resolves the
va_*() macros too).

9 years agoOvmfPkg: flash driver: drop needlessly wide multiplication (VS2010)
Scott Duplichan [Fri, 14 Nov 2014 10:23:43 +0000 (10:23 +0000)]
OvmfPkg: flash driver: drop needlessly wide multiplication (VS2010)

The current types of subexpressions used in QemuFlashPtr() are as follows.
(We also show the types of "larger" subexpressions, according to operator
binding.)

  mFlashBase + (Lba * mFdBlockSize) + Offset
      ^          ^         ^            ^
      |          |         |            |
   (UINT8*)   EFI_LBA    UINTN        UINTN
              (UINT64)

  ---------------------------------   ------
              (UINT8*)                UINTN

  ------------------------------------------
                    (UINT8*)

When building with VS2010 for Ia32 / NOOPT, the 64-by-32 bit
multiplication is translated to an intrinsic, which is not allowed in
edk2.

Recognize that "Lba" is always bounded by "mFdBlockCount" (an UINTN) here
-- all callers of QemuFlashPtr() ensure that. In addition, the flash chip
in question is always under 4GB, which is why we can address it at all on
Ia32. Narrow "Lba" to UINTN, without any loss of range.

9 years agoOvmfPg: flash driver: fix type of EFI_SIZE_TO_PAGES argument (VS2010)
Laszlo Ersek [Fri, 14 Nov 2014 10:23:21 +0000 (10:23 +0000)]
OvmfPg: flash driver: fix type of EFI_SIZE_TO_PAGES argument (VS2010)

The MarkMemoryRangeForRuntimeAccess() function passes the Length parameter
(of type UINT64) to the macro EFI_SIZE_TO_PAGES(). When building for the
Ia32 platform, this violates the interface contract of the macro:

    [...] Passing in a parameter that is larger than UINTN may produce
    unexpected results.

In addition, it trips up compilation by VS2010 for the Ia32 platform and
the NOOPT target -- it generates calls to intrinsics, which are not
allowed in edk2.

Fix both issues with the following steps:

(1) Demote the Length parameter of MarkMemoryRangeForRuntimeAccess() to
UINTN. Even a UINT32 value is plenty for representing the size of the
flash chip holding the variable store. Length parameter is used in the
following contexts:
- passed to gDS->RemoveMemorySpace() -- takes an UINT64
- passed to gDS->AddMemorySpace() -- ditto
- passed to EFI_SIZE_TO_PAGES() -- requires an UINTN. This also guarantees
  that the return type of EFI_SIZE_TO_PAGES() will be UINTN, hence we can
  drop the outer cast.

(2) The only caller of MarkMemoryRangeForRuntimeAccess() is
FvbInitialize(). The latter function populates the local Length variable
(passed to MarkMemoryRangeForRuntimeAccess()) from
PcdGet32(PcdOvmfFirmwareFdSize). Therefore we can simply demote the local
variable to UINTN in this function as well.
- There's only one other use of Length in FvbInitialize(): it is passed to
  GetFvbInfo(). GetFvbInfo() takes an UINT64, so passing an UINTN is fine.

9 years agoOvmfPkg: AcpiTimerLib: Split into multiple phase-specific instances
Gabriel Somlo [Fri, 14 Nov 2014 00:38:17 +0000 (00:38 +0000)]
OvmfPkg: AcpiTimerLib: Split into multiple phase-specific instances

Remove local power management register access macros in favor of
factored-out ones in OvmfPkg/Include/OvmfPlatforms.h

Next, AcpiTimerLib is split out into three instances, for use during
various stages:

  - BaseRom: used during SEC, PEI_CORE, and PEIM;
  - Dxe:     used during DXE_DRIVER and DXE_RUNTIME_DRIVER;
  - Base:    used by default during all other stages.

Most of the code remains in AcpiTimerLib.c, to be shared by all
instances. The two platform-dependent methods (constructor and
InternalAcpiGetTimerTick) are provided separately by source files
specific to each instance, namely [BaseRom|Base|Dxe]AcpiTimerLib.c.

Since pre-DXE stages can't rely on storing data in global variables,
methods specific to the "BaseRom" instance will call platform
detection macros each time they're invoked.

The "Base" instance calls platform detection macros only from its
constructor, and caches the address required by InternalAcpiTimerTick
in a global variable.

The "Dxe" instance is very similar to "Base", except no platform
detection macros are called at all; instead, the platform type is
read via a dynamic PCD set from PlatformPei.
